Vehicle Description
2005 Chevy Aveo LS hatchback in very good condition with only 64,425 miles on the odometer. Equipped with front wheel drive, the 5-speed manual transmission is coupled to a fuel-efficient 1.6L four-cylinder engine that starts every time and runs like a top.
This Aveo seats five, is equipped with enough LATCH anchors for two car seats, and the hatchback design combined with the 60/40 folding rear seats, flip-up rear seat bottoms, and tall ceiling make for many versatile cargo carrying configurations. It is equipped with the below options:
— 103-HP 1.6L DOHC I-4 Engine
— 5-Speed Manual Transmission
— 3.94:1 Drive Axle Ratio (FWD)
— 4-Wheel Anti-Lock Brakes
— Air Conditioning
— Tinted Windows
— Heated & Folding Side View Mirrors
— Daytime Running Lights
— Tilt Steering
— Manual Windows, Locks, Seats, Mirrors
— CD/MP3/Radio Player
— Aftermarket ScanGaugeE Trip Computer
— Cloth Interior w/color-matched Seat Covers
— Removable Cargo Area Sun Shade
— Rear Spoiler
— 4-Wheel Mud Guards
I have performed regular preventative maintenance on this vehicle since purchasing it, and it is currently in excellent mechanical condition. Engine oil has been changed every 3,000 miles with synthetic Pennzoil Platinum 5W-30, and I consistently drain the full capacity.
The timing belt, water pump, thermostat, and serpentine belt were all proactively replaced 5,000 miles ago per the recommended maintenance schedule. I also performed a minor tune-up within the last 100 miles that included replacing the below wear items:
— Front Brake Pads, Rotors, & Calipers
— Spark Plugs & Wires
— Valve Cover & Throttle Body Gaskets
— Engine & Cabin Air Filters
— Motor Oil & Filter
— Windshield Wiper Blades
I tend to be overly fastidious about these things, and have taken the time to verify that all features and functions work as they should — there are no idiot lights on, the A/C blows cold, all exterior lights and turn signals work as expected, and all four speakers work properly.
The cloth interior is in virtually flawless condition, thanks to the color-coordinated seat covers and the all-season rubber floor mats. We are non-smokers, and the car has never been used to transport animals.
The exterior is in very good overall condition, with the only significant flaw existing in the form of a small area of flaking top coat on the driver side of the rear bumper cover. I've photographed this area for sake of reference — it is barely visible from a distance of 5-6' away.
The Masterforce Strategy P185/65R14 tires have 15,114 miles on them and came with a 65,000 mile warranty. Combined with the front wheel drive of the Aveo, I have found snow performance to be above average when navigating unplowed rural roads and our (hilly) country drive.
I am an optimizer and efficiency nut by nature, and manually calculate my MPG at every fill-up. The aftermarket ScanGaugeE trip computer / fuel economy gauge provides additional data points in the form of instant and average fuel economy as well. I historically average about 30-32 MPG in mixed driving, but can consistently obtain 35-37 MPG at speeds of 55–60 MPH.
My wife and I originally purchased this car used in 2011, from what I believe to be the original owners. The Aveo served as both our daily driver and trip vehicle for several years, after which it was relegated solely to daily driver status after our acquisition of another slightly larger hatchback. The extremely low mileage for the year is a result of my daily commute consisting of only a few miles each way.
Our primary reason for selling is that our growing family of four has my wife and I contemplating embracing the undeniable utility of the mini-van.
This car is in great running condition, needs nothing, and was recently detailed. Comes with electronic copies of the Build Sheet, Owner's Manual, and Service Manual.
